  • Beschreibung: This study examines changing patterns of civil service coverage and employee job protections in U.S. state civil service systems during the period FY 1999-FY 2006. Data come from surveys of state personnel directors in 2000 and 2007 and secondary sources. Several research questions are addressed: has state civil service coverage expanded or contracted during the study period; have employee job protections increased or decreased; and how have these and other related changes affected employee turnover? Our findings show that considerable change occurred in some states during the study period, with civil service coverage both increasing and decreasing. However, not much change occurred across the states as a whole. We also found that levels and patterns of employee job protection varied across the states. Moreover, some states employ large numbers of non-classified workers, including political appointees and temporary workers, and they tend to give these employees varying levels of protection. Regression analyses show that these factors affect voluntary and involuntary turnover in interesting ways
